Compatibility, explained: what a full synastry reading actually measures

Forget "sign compatibility" — that's the horoscope-column version

Somewhere along the way, "compatibility" got flattened into a party trick: you're a Leo, they're a Scorpio, so it's doomed — or you're both water signs, so it must be written in the stars. That's the horoscope-column version, and it's about as revealing as judging a novel by the font on its cover. Sun-sign matching squeezes a whole person into one of twelve boxes, then squeezes an entire relationship into a lookup table. Two people who share a Sun sign can be wildly different, and two people whose Sun signs supposedly "clash" can fit together like a hand in a glove.

The trouble is scale. Your Sun sign is a single data point among dozens. Reducing the bond between two whole human beings to one comparison throws away almost everything that actually shapes how they relate — and then dresses up the little that's left as destiny.

What synastry actually is

Real compatibility work is called synastry, and it compares two complete birth charts, not two zodiac labels. A birth chart maps where every planet sat at the exact moment and place you were born. Lay two of those charts over each other and you can see how one person's planets touch the other's — a comparison far richer than any Sun-sign pairing. Precision is what makes the difference here. Astrollo computes planetary positions from the Swiss Ephemeris to within roughly a thousandth of a degree, which is why an accurate birth time isn't a nice-to-have — it's load-bearing. The Moon moves through the zodiac fast, changing sign roughly every two and a half days, so even the calendar date can nudge it over a boundary. The Ascendant, or rising sign, shifts by about one degree every four minutes — a full sign roughly every two hours — and it anchors the entire house framework. Get the time wrong by an hour and you may be reading the wrong emotional temperature and the wrong house overlays altogether.

The mechanics, in brief

Three moving parts do most of the work:

  • Inter-chart aspects. These are the angles between one person's planet and the other's — a conjunction, a trine, a square. They describe the chemistry of contact: easy flow, friction, or magnetism.
  • Orbs. An aspect only counts when it's close enough to exact. A trine that's ten degrees off is a near-miss, not a trine — the way a note played a half-step flat isn't the chord you meant. Tight orbs carry weight; loose ones fade into the background. Our page on aspects and orbs breaks the tolerances down.
  • House overlays. Where your partner's planet lands within your chart changes its meaning completely. Their Venus in your seventh house of partnership reads like an invitation; the same Venus in your twelfth house of the hidden and the unspoken reads like something quieter, harder to name.

The four dimensions of a bond

A useful reading follows four separate currents rather than a single verdict:

  1. Emotional resonance — Moon-to-Moon contacts, and how instinctively two people feel safe with each other (or don't).
  2. Communication — Mercury links, and whether you think in compatible rhythms or keep talking past one another.
  3. Attraction — Venus and Mars cross-aspects, the pull between what one person loves and how the other pursues.
  4. Long-term direction — the Sun, Jupiter, and the lunar nodes, which speak to shared values and the sense that a bond is "going somewhere."

A relationship can run strong in one current and thin in another. That isn't a flaw in the method — it's the method telling you something honest.

A worked mini-reading

Take a neutral, unnamed pair and read just three contacts.

  • Her Moon trine his Sun. His core identity naturally warms her emotional world; she feels seen without having to explain herself.
  • His Mercury square her Mars. Conversation sparks fast and heats up faster — debate feels electric, but small disagreements can escalate before either of them notices.
  • Her Venus conjunct his Ascendant. She's drawn to the way he shows up in a room; the attraction is immediate and physical, tied to first impressions.

Read together, these three sketch a couple with real warmth and chemistry, plus one friction point worth watching: the pace and edge of how they argue. Notice that none of this depends on their Sun signs at all.

Three well-chosen contacts tell you more than any Sun-sign verdict — not who's "right" for whom, but where the ease lives and where the work is.

Honest limits

None of this is medical, therapeutic, legal, or financial advice, and it should never stand in for any of them. A chart shows tendencies, not verdicts — leanings, not locks. No aspect dooms a relationship and no trine guarantees one. If a reading ever lands like a sentence handed down from on high, that's a misreading of what it can do. You keep full authorship of your choices; the chart is a lens, never a judge.

What the evidence says, plainly

Here's the part most compatibility content quietly skips. In controlled, blind studies, astrology has shown no confirmed ability to predict who will pair well or who will last — the specific claims simply don't hold up under proper testing, and we're not going to pretend otherwise. Ptolemy and Kepler were serious minds, but seriousness isn't the same as predictive proof, and astrology has no confirmed predictive power.

So what is it good for? Synastry works best as a shared language — a mirror a couple can hold up to talk about difference, friction, and fit with a little less blame and a little more curiosity. Its value is reflective, not prophetic. It won't tell you what happens next. What it can do is hand you better questions to ask each other — and honestly, that's often the more useful thing anyway.
